The ss Great Britain Trust has been awarded nearly £5 million by the Heritage Lottery Fund (HLF) for funding towards a new museum.
Being Brunel: the national Brunel project, is set to open in easter 2017 and will be located on Bristol's waterfront.
The new museum will feature galleries and interactive experiences set in reconstructed buildings that will reflect the 'original Victorian waterfront panorama'.
Brunel's Drawing Office, a Grade II listed building, will be restored to become part of the new museum.
With HLF Funding, the £7.1 million project is now 90% funded, with an additional £670,000 needed to complete the project.
Brunel's ss Great Britain remaining open for the duration of the build.
Matthew Tanner MBE, Chief Executive of the ss Great Britain Trust said: "I am delighted that the Heritage Lottery Fund has given its support to Being Brunel: the national project."
